Transaction ccb157900d85b1620a5bdec07e284ef1d51dc901a8e381d4a563a7b1fcb344cf

block
54eb9d9c34570888fa600711d3cebd6fb014ea0a77f59fac1bf6171ecb302689

28 Inputs

2 Outputs